The British Chamber of Commerce is pleased to invite you to a BCC Live Event - Legal Webinar: “2021 Legal Update - Post-Brexit, Continuing Pandemic - what's next?!" This will take place online on Wednesday 24 March at 18:00.
Our legal experts will provide a high-level legal update post-completion of Brexit and bearing the ever-ongoing Covid-19 situation in mind, and will help you find the answers to current hot topics:
Employment law: "Covid-19 vaccines – What can employers do?”
Banking & Finance law: "What’s the good news and the bad news?”
Corporate law: "Covid-19 in a post brexit Luxembourg: What impact on corporate governance, branches, European corporate entities, cross-border mergers, governing law and jurisdiction clauses?”
Data Protection law:
"Personal data transfers post-Brexit - mind the gap: Is it sufficient to rely on the forthcoming adequacy decision to have personal data transferred to the UK?”
“Processing personal data in the COVID-19 context - about flattened curves and peaking investigations: What flexibility for the processing of health data in the current COVID-19 context?”
